Masonry repair services involve the restoration and preservation of existing masonry structures, including brick, stone, concrete, and mortar. These services typically address issues such as cracks, crumbling mortar joints, spalling bricks, and other forms of deterioration that compromise the structural integrity and aesthetic appeal of masonry elements. Skilled professionals assess the extent of damage and use appropriate techniques to repair or replace damaged materials, ensuring the longevity and stability of the structure. Proper masonry repair helps maintain the original appearance while preventing further deterioration caused by weather, moisture, or age.

Many common problems that masonry repair services aim to solve include foundation cracks, leaning or bulging walls, and damaged chimneys. Over time, exposure to environmental elements can lead to mortar joints eroding or bricks becoming loose, which can threaten the safety of the property. Repair work may involve repointing mortar joints, replacing damaged bricks or stones, and sealing cracks to prevent water infiltration. Addressing these issues promptly can help avoid more extensive and costly repairs in the future, as well as safeguard the structural soundness of the building.

What types of masonry repair services are available? Local masonry service providers typically offer repairs for cracks, spalling, and damaged mortar joints, as well as rebuilding and restoring brick, stone, or concrete structures.

How can I tell if my masonry needs repair? Signs such as visible cracks, bulging, crumbling mortar, or water infiltration may indicate that masonry repair is needed; consulting with a local professional can provide an assessment.

What are common causes of masonry damage? Damage often results from weathering, freeze-thaw cycles, settling, or structural movement, which can compromise the integrity of masonry surfaces.

How long does masonry repair typically take? The duration of repair work varies depending on the extent of damage and the scope of the project; a local contractor can provide an estimate based on the specific condition.

Is maintenance required after masonry repair? Some maintenance may be recommended to preserve the repair, such as sealing or regular inspections, which local service providers can advise on.
